Output ecf3ef72b70986f7419ef19e9e995e1a6cd9e37d3f34da00dc0fcd04c332aae6:5

value
1459194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75b2c024f4baa0f4b64ecec5880abdc2a6d3c390 OP_EQUALVERIFY OP_CHECKSIG
address
1BjLCFZcLza58TcDAWxLjrwzYAiNcB1MKT
transaction
ecf3ef72b70986f7419ef19e9e995e1a6cd9e37d3f34da00dc0fcd04c332aae6
spent
true